PHP中的title是網頁開發中非常重要的一個元素。它不僅能夠提供網頁的標題,還能夠影響搜索引擎優化的效果。在本文中,我們將探討如何在PHP中使用title元素,并且給出一些例子來加深理解。
首先,我們需要了解什么是title。title是一個HTML元素,通常被放在HTML文檔的head部分。它在瀏覽器中顯示網頁的標題,同時也會出現在搜索結果中。在PHP中,我們可以動態地生成title元素,以便于用戶更容易地辨認網頁內容。
在下面的例子中,我們可以看到如何使用PHP來生成title元素:
在這個例子中,我們使用了PHP的echo語句來輸出網站的標題。通過這種方式,我們可以動態地生成網頁標題,從而提高用戶對網頁內容的理解。
除了簡單的動態生成title之外,我們還可以使用一些PHP函數來進一步優化title的效果。例如,我們可以使用str_replace函數來替換title中的特定字符,或者使用substr函數來限制title的長度。
以下是這些函數的用法示例:
在這個例子中,我們使用了str_replace函數來將冒號和逗號轉換為分隔符。接著,我們使用了substr函數來限制title的長度,避免過長導致顯示不全。最終的結果是一個簡短、易于理解的標題。
除了以上的基本用法之外,我們還可以利用一些PHP框架來進一步優化title元素的生成。例如,在Laravel框架中,我們可以通過定義一個Layout模板文件來統一生成title元素:
在這個示例中,我們使用了Laravel框架提供的Blade模板引擎來動態地插入title元素。通過定義一個Layout模板文件,我們可以在所有網頁中使用同樣的title格式,提高網站的整體一致性。
總之,PHP中的title元素是非常重要的一個元素。它不僅能夠提供網站的標題,還能夠影響搜索引擎優化的效果。通過使用PHP動態地生成title元素,我們可以更好地為用戶提供有價值的內容。希望本文的解釋和示例能夠幫助讀者在實際項目開發中更好地使用title元素。
首先,我們需要了解什么是title。title是一個HTML元素,通常被放在HTML文檔的head部分。它在瀏覽器中顯示網頁的標題,同時也會出現在搜索結果中。在PHP中,我們可以動態地生成title元素,以便于用戶更容易地辨認網頁內容。
在下面的例子中,我們可以看到如何使用PHP來生成title元素:
<head> <title><?php echo "這個網站的標題" ?></title> </head>
在這個例子中,我們使用了PHP的echo語句來輸出網站的標題。通過這種方式,我們可以動態地生成網頁標題,從而提高用戶對網頁內容的理解。
除了簡單的動態生成title之外,我們還可以使用一些PHP函數來進一步優化title的效果。例如,我們可以使用str_replace函數來替換title中的特定字符,或者使用substr函數來限制title的長度。
以下是這些函數的用法示例:
<head> <?php $title = "這是一個帶有特殊字符的標題,例如 colon: 和 comma,"; $title = str_replace(array(":", ","), " -", $title); $title = substr($title, 0, 60) . "..."; ?> <title><?php echo $title ?></title> </head>
在這個例子中,我們使用了str_replace函數來將冒號和逗號轉換為分隔符。接著,我們使用了substr函數來限制title的長度,避免過長導致顯示不全。最終的結果是一個簡短、易于理解的標題。
除了以上的基本用法之外,我們還可以利用一些PHP框架來進一步優化title元素的生成。例如,在Laravel框架中,我們可以通過定義一個Layout模板文件來統一生成title元素:
<!-- resources/views/layouts/app.blade.php --> <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>@yield('title') - My Awesome App</title> </head> <body> @yield('content') </body> </html>
在這個示例中,我們使用了Laravel框架提供的Blade模板引擎來動態地插入title元素。通過定義一個Layout模板文件,我們可以在所有網頁中使用同樣的title格式,提高網站的整體一致性。
總之,PHP中的title元素是非常重要的一個元素。它不僅能夠提供網站的標題,還能夠影響搜索引擎優化的效果。通過使用PHP動態地生成title元素,我們可以更好地為用戶提供有價值的內容。希望本文的解釋和示例能夠幫助讀者在實際項目開發中更好地使用title元素。
上一篇ajax得到asp返回值
下一篇vue自動換行